Output fecb6715094114835ddaf97a55f930d5c29467f3a8be50428e69a05eeebfb380:101
- value
- 1649070
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30cbc93462ee43618f64e4b40e187652a97110e8 OP_EQUAL
- address
- 3692V3jrXvyj8vwDXUmcYJhNj5cnkL1h5M
- transaction
- fecb6715094114835ddaf97a55f930d5c29467f3a8be50428e69a05eeebfb380
- confirmations
- 160278
- spent
- true